jak1/jak2: Persist sound settings, play-hints, subtitles and vibration settings in `pc-settings` instead of the memory card file (#3612)
In the original game, they had no choice but to use the memory card file
as their method of persisting settings. We are not limited by such
things.

It's inconvenient to have to load your save-file when launching the game
to initialize these settings to your liking, it's also confusing
behaviour to even some players that have played the game heavily for
over a decade. We can do better by globally saving these settings to the
`pc-settings` file instead.

Originally I only migrated the volume settings, then i figured it would
be nice to also have play-hints and subtitles settings persisted. More
could debatably be moved (language is a big one...) but these were the
low hanging fruit.

I also reduced the default volumes as that is something else that has
come up a few times.
